I just purchased my Hondata FlashPro. I tried installing it and making sure all the checks were green in the FlashPro Window.
I am getting only one issue and that is the firmware. It has a warning sign and per the instructions, I am supposed to have all green checks. I
am running the latest Hondata FlashPro Manager Software (3.9.3.0).
I read in other posts that there may be an issue with USB3 (which is all the new modern laptops have). I also read that to unplug + plug the USB cable from the laptop several times would do the trick. But NO.
Then in the Quick Guide, I read that you can update the Boot Firmware, and since my issue says "Bootloader Checksum: 0x6E5CE512". I also see that the Bootloader version is 1. Hence I though perhaps the Boot Firmware needs to be updated. The guide actually says you can go to the Help Menu and click on "Update FlashPro Boot Firmware" . So I tried it, but it keeps just failing. It says to try again, but even after multiple tries, it does not update anything.
Then I thought perhaps it's my laptop (gaming laptop with 32GB of Ram and all USB3 and USBC ports) perhaps is too new. So I tried in other "elderly" laptops which have USB2. But they are all giving me the same issue "Failed. Please try again before un-plugging the FlashPro"
If someone has experiences this , please let me know how I can possible fix this. Else please suggest how to contact Hondata to see if I can get a replacement (maybe its the FlashPro Issue) or troubleshooting steps. I am not able to see anybody else struggling with this.
